Note that for free we expose only a fraction of our full database. We also only expose a Ton CO2/Turnover efficiency - while in fact, each sector has an optimal efficiency metric. Retail for example compares emissions on a Ton CO2/m2 or /ft2, raw materials manufacturing on a per Ton production basis (e.g. cement, steel).
